About this property

Cinema Hotel - an Atlas Boutique Hotel

Take in the views from the rooftop terrace when you stay at Cinema Hotel - an Atlas Boutique Hotel. You can relax with a drink at the bar/lounge, and the restaurant is the perfect spot to grab a bite to eat. Other highlights at this Mediterranean hotel include free bike rentals and a terrace. Fellow travellers say great things about the helpful staff.

Fees & policies

Mandatory fees

You'll be asked to pay the following charges by the property at check-in or checkout. Fees may include applicable taxes:
  • You may be required to pay the following charge at the property: Israel value-added tax (VAT) at 18%. A VAT exemption is available to travellers who present a valid passport and tourist visa showing that they are not a resident of Israel.

Optional extras

  • Airport shuttle service is offered for an extra charge of ILS 250 per room (one way)

Children & extra beds

  • Rollaway beds are available for ILS 250.0 per night

Parking

  • Parking is available nearby and costs ILS 80 per day (820 ft away)

Verified

10/10 Exceptional

It is a gem in Tel Aviv across Dissengoff square It used to be the Esther Cinema then transformed into a hotel. It is set up as a museum of cinema and the top of the hotel there is an incredible view of Tel Aviv. At early evening they have a happy hour. The breakfast also is very good. The rooms a little small, however all the other amenities are excellent,
